The Museum of the Journey to the Alcarria
The Museum of the Journey to the Alcarria, situated in Torija, is dedicated to Camilo José Cela’s magnificent novel, and was opened on the 50th anniversary of its publication.

The museum is set amid incomparable beauty, in the keep of Torija Castle, and it houses a collection of personal mementos, things that the writer and Nobel Prize winner, Camilo José Cela, used during his journey through the lands of Guadalajara in 1946 and later evoked in his book Journey to the Alcarria.
It includes photographs from the time, texts, maps, utensils and tools owned by Cela, as well as unique editions of his books.
